Remedies Upon Default. If any Event of Default shall have occurred and be continuing: (a) The Collateral Agent may exercise in respect of any Collateral (granted by any or all of the Grantors), in addition to other rights and remedies provided for herein or otherwise available to it, all the rights and remedies of a secured party under the UCC and/or any other applicable law and/or in equity and also may do any or all of the following, whether separately, successively, or simultaneously, all to the extent permitted under the UCC, any other applicable law and/or the Credit Agreement: (i) In the name of the Collateral Agent, or in the name of any Grantor, or otherwise, enforce each Grantor's rights against any account debtor or other obligor, and may demand, sue for, collect or receive any money or property at any time payable or receivable on Exhibit 4.01(c) 7 account of or in exchange for, or make any compromise or settlement deemed desirable with respect to, any of the Collateral, but the Collateral Agent shall be under no obligation so to do, and the Collateral Agent, may extend the time of payment, arrange for payment in installments, or otherwise modify the terms of, or release, any of the Collateral without thereby incurring responsibility to, or discharging or otherwise affecting any liability of, any Grantor. (ii) Subject to applicable law and the terms of any lease agreement that may apply, enter upon any premises where any Collateral may be, and take possession thereof, and maintain such possession on the applicable Grantor's premises, or demand and receive such possession from any Person who has possession thereof, or remove the Collateral or any part thereof, to such other places as the Collateral Agent may desire, without any obligation to pay such Grantor for any use and occupancy of such premises. (iii) Require any Grantor to, and each Grantor hereby agrees that it will at its expense and upon request of the Collateral Agent forthwith, assemble all or part of the Collateral as directed by the Collateral Agent and make it available to the Collateral Agent at a place to be designated by the Collateral Agent which is reasonably convenient to both parties. (iv) Without notice except as specified below and with or without taking the possession thereof, sell, assign, grant an option or options to purchase or otherwise dispose of the Collateral or any part thereof in one or more parcels at public or private sale, at any location chosen by the Collateral Agent, for cash, on credit or for future delivery, and at such price or prices and upon such other terms as the Collateral Agent may deem commercially reasonable. Each Grantor hereby agrees that, to the extent notice of sale shall be required by law, at least seven (7) Business Days' notice to such Grantor of the time and place of any public sale or the time after which any private sale is to be made shall constitute reasonable notification, but notice given in any other reasonable manner or at any other reasonable time shall constitute reasonable notification. The Collateral Agent shall not be obligated to make any sale of Collateral regardless of notice of sale having been given. The Collateral Agent may adjourn any public or private sale from time to time by announcement at the time and place fixed therefor, and such sale may, without further notice, be made at the time and place to which it was so adjourned. Each Grantor hereby agrees that the Collateral Agent shall have no obligation to preserve rights in the Collateral against prior parties or to marshal any Collateral for the benefit of any Person. (v) Whether or not any Obligations shall have matured or shall have been accelerated pursuant to the Credit Agreement or otherwise, the Collateral Agent may in addition to any other rights it may have under this Agreement or otherwise, appoint by instrument in writing a receiver or receiver and manager (both of which are herein called a "Receiver") of all or any part of the Collateral or may institute proceedings in any court of competent jurisdiction for the appointment of such a Receiver. Any such Receiver is hereby given and shall have the same powers and rights as the Collateral Agent has under this Agreement, at law or in equity. In exercising any such powers, any such Receiver shall act as, and for all purposes shall be deemed to be, the agent of the applicable Grantor and neither the Collateral Agent nor any other member of the Lender Group shall be responsible for any act or omission of any such Receiver absent the willful misconduct of the Collateral Agent or the Exhibit 4.01(c) 8 Receiver. The Collateral Agent may appoint one or more Receivers hereunder and may remove any such Receiver or Receivers and appoint another or other in his or their stead from time to time. Any Receiver so appointed may be an officer or employee of the Collateral Agent or any Lender. Each Grantor agrees that any Receiver appointed by the Collateral Agent need not be appointed by, nor is his appointment required to be ratified by, nor his actions in any way supervised by, a court. (vi) Apply, without notice, any cash or cash items constituting Collateral in the possession of the Collateral Agent or any other member of the Lender Group, in a manner consistent with the Credit Agreement, to payment of any of the Obligations. Each Grantor hereby waives, to the extent permitted by applicable law, all rights of such Grantor to prior notice and hearing under any applicable statute or constitution (in the case of such notice only, to the extent that such statute or constitution gives rights as to notice that are greater than are provided for herein or provides for any notice period when none is otherwise provided for herein). (b) All cash proceeds received by the Collateral Agent under foregoing subsection (a), in respect of any sale of, collection from, or other realization upon, all or any part of the Collateral granted by any or all of the Grantors may, in the discretion of the Collateral Agent, be held by the Collateral Agent as Collateral for, and/or may then or at any time thereafter be applied (after payment of any amounts payable to the Collateral Agent or any other member of the Lender Group pursuant to Section 18 hereof) in whole or in part by the Collateral Agent against all or any part of the Obligations, in such order as the Collateral Agent shall elect consistent with any requirements in the Credit Agreement. Any surplus of such cash or cash proceeds held by the Collateral Agent and remaining after payment in full of all the Obligations shall be paid over to the applicable Grantor or Grantors or to whomsoever may be lawfully entitled to receive such surplus. 17.
